Use Case: Upload Revised Document
Actors
- Loan Processor
- Loan Origination System (LOS)
- Electronic Content Management Repository (ECM)
Description A loan processor requests the upload of a revised document version to an existing loan transaction folder in a document repository.
Assumptions and Preconditions
- The Loan Processor is properly set up in both the LOS and the ECM, and has access rights assigned to her user accounts for both.
- The LOS has produced or has access to a revised version of a document within set of document files related to a particular loan transaction, in a standard format.
- The LOS has persisted the name of the folder where the revised document exists within the ECM.
- The Loan Processor is logged into the LOS and has selected a document to be sent.
Postconditions A new revision of the specified document file, together with any metadata needed to search for the new revision, are stored and accessible on the ECM.
Normal Flow
- The Processor selects the loan transaction that contains the revised document.
- The Processor selects an option to send the revised document to the ECM.
- The LOS creates a MISMO-compliant request to the ECM.
- The LOS logs into the ECM using credentials provided by the Processor.
- The ECM grants access to the LOS and provides permission to its repository.
- The LOS sends a message including the following:
- The location and name of the folder containing the existing document.
- The embedded or referenced content stream and any revised metadata for the replacing document.
- If supported, versioning instructions
- If supported, the ECM adds the new content to the repository as a version update to the existing document and marks it as the latest version. Otherwise, it replaces the existing document with the new one.
- The ECM returns MISMO-compliant response, including the status of each step of its process, and any version labels it has created to identify a new document version.
- The LOS displays the status of the upload request to the Processor.
